- Determine the effects of healthcare policy on nursing roles and healthcare delivery.
Nurses play a crucial role in the healthcare system, and their role is greatly impacted by healthcare policies. The COVID-19 pandemic has highlighted the importance of nurses in the healthcare system as they are on the frontlines of the pandemic, administering vaccines, and providing care to patients. The COVID-19 vaccine mandate has increased the role of nurses in the healthcare system as they are responsible for administering the vaccine to the public. This has also highlighted the need for nurses to be trained and educated on the vaccine’s administration, storage, and handling, which is essential for the successful implementation of the vaccine mandate.
Telemedicine is another area where nurses play a significant role in healthcare delivery. The COVID-19 pandemic has accelerated the adoption of telemedicine, and nurses are often the primary point of contact for patients during telehealth visits. They are responsible for collecting patient information, performing assessments, and providing education and support to patients. This has led to an expansion of the role of nurses in the healthcare system as they are now responsible for providing care in a virtual setting.
